First, the League of Women Voters is putting on two forums for all preliminary city council and mayoral elections — details below. You can catch me at the first one on Monday! (Please note that tickets are fully reserved for the Bombyx event, but you can stream it live at Northampton Open Media!)

Second, the Northampton High School Student Union will be holding a somewhat smaller forum with mayoral, at-large city council and contested school committee candidates on September 29th. While I won’t be speaking there, the student perspective on this election is essential and should be front and center in discourse around our public schools.
